A bomb threat in Stamford set residents of southwestern Connecticut on edge Tuesday following a similar scare in Bridgeport the day before.
Authorities say they received a call at 9:30 a.m. from Lauri Glatzer, of Stamford, who said she arrived to work at the Body Quest Gym on Long Ridge Road with her co-worker, Erika Yarmoff, and found a suspicious suitcase in her parking spot.
"I knew it was strange that a piece of luggage was there, but I actually got out of my car and moved it," Yarmoff says.
A six-member bomb squad arrived on the scene shortly before 10 a.m. and evacuated the gym and a nearby Dunkin' Donuts café. The bomb squad took X-rays of the suitcase to determine its contents were not hazardous before opening it with a mechanical device. Police say inside they found miscellaneous items, including loose change and a deodorant stick.
"We responded, and we conducted our render safe procedures to determine there were not explosive components in the package," says Sgt. Lou DeRubeis, of the Stamford Police Department.
